Undertaker “final farewell” set for the Survivor Series

WWE issued a press release today hyping Undertaker’s Final Farewell at the Survivor Series on Sunday, November 22, capping off The Phenom’s legendary 30-year career.

Apart from a list of WWE Network shows being aired to celebrate Taker’s 30-year WWE career, there was no other information on what this final farewell will entail.

The Undertaker is set to appear live in person at the ThunderDome at the pay-per-view but is not scheduled to wrestle on the show. The Survivor Series in 1990 was the birthplace of The Undertaker and since then, the legendary man behind the gimmick went on to have one of the most decorated careers in professional wrestling history.

During the final episode of Undertaker: The Last Ride, Taker said that it was the end of the road for him and has no intention of stepping back in the ring for another match, although he did leave the door slightly open with a “never say never.”
